Boho wedding dresses and features

The Wedding dresses boho are known for their distinct features that set them apart from the traditional wedding dresses. The first key element is the flowing silhouette. Unlike structured dresses, boho wedding dresses feature loose, flowing fabrics that create an ethereal and romantic look. These boho wedding dresses often incorporate lightweight materials like chiffon and organza, allowing the bride to move with grace and ease throughout her wedding day.


Another feature in Wedding dresses boho is the use of delicate lace. The lace adds a touch of femininity and vintage charm to the dress, creating a soft and romantic aesthetics. Whether it's intricate lace, boho-inspired crochet lace, or delicate floral patterns, lace is a staple of boho wedding dresses.


In addition to flowing silhouettes and delicate lace, the wedding dresses boho often feature unique details such as floral embellishments, embroidery and fringes. These details add texture and visual interest to the dress, giving it a bohemian feel. Whether it's a cascading floral appliqué, hand-stitched embroidery or playful details, these unique elements make boho dresses truly unique.

How to find the perfect boho wedding dress for your body type

Finding the perfect boho wedding dress for your body type is all about knowing how to accentuate your best features while maintaining a bohemian aesthetic. Here are some tips to help you find the dress that flatters your figure:

For pear-shaped brides: If you have a smaller bust and wider hips, consider a boho dress with an A-line or empire waist. These styles will highlight your waist and flow over your hips, creating a balanced and flattering look. Choose one dress with delicate lace or intricate embellishments on the bodice to draw attention upwards.


For hourglass-shaped brides: If you have a well-defined waist and balanced proportions, a boho dress with a mermaid or trumpet silhouette will accentuate your curves beautifully. Look for a dress with a fitted bodice and a skirt that flares below the hips. Consider dresses with lace or floral appliqué details to enhance the romantic and bohemian vibe.


For apple-shaped brides: If you carry most of your weight around your waist, go for a boho dress with an empire waist or flowing silhouette. These styles will skim your stomach and create a flattering, elongated look. Choose dresses with V-necks or necklines to draw attention to your upper body.


For petite brides: If you have a petite frame, look for boho dresses with a sheath or column silhouette. These styles will elongate your figure and create the illusion of height. Avoid dresses with too much fabric or heavy embellishments as they can overwhelm your frame. Choose dresses with delicate lace or subtle embroidery to maintain the boho aesthetic without overpowering your small stature.

 

Remember, these are just guidelines and the most important thing is to choose a dress that makes you feel beautiful and confident. Don't be afraid to try different styles and consult a bridal consultant who can provide expert advice tailored to your body type.

Boho wedding dresses and tips

Shopping for boho wedding dresses can be an exciting and enjoyable experience. Here are some tips to help you get the most out of your dress shopping trip:

 

Do your research: Before you hit the bridal boutiques, take some time to research different designers and styles of boho dresses. Browse bridal magazines, Pinterest boards, and wedding blogs to gather inspiration and get a sense of the styles that appeal to you. This will help you narrow down your options and get the most out of your bridal appointments.


Set a budget: Boho wedding dresses come in a wide range of prices, so it's important to set a budget before you start shopping. Determine how much money you are willing to spend on your dress and communicate this to your bridal consultant. They will be able to guide you towards dresses within your budget and prevent you from falling in love with a dress that is beyond your means.


Book your appointments in advance: Bridal boutiques can be busy, especially during peak wedding season. To ensure you get the bridal consultants' undivided attention, it's best to book your appointments in advance. This will also give you enough time to try different styles and make an informed decision.


Be open to trying different styles: While you may have a specific boho wedding dress style in mind, it's always worth trying a variety of styles to see what suits you best. The dress you least expect may end up being the one that steals your heart. Keep an open mind and trust the expertise of bridal consultants who can recommend styles that flatter your body type and align with your vision.


Bring the right underwear: When trying on boho wedding dresses, it's essential to wear the right undergarments to get an accurate sense of how the dress will fit on your wedding day. Choose nude underwear without seams that do not detract from the dress. If you plan to wear clothes or a certain style of bra, bring them along to your appointments.


Take pictures: It can be tiring to try a lot wedding dresses and it's easy to forget the details once you leave the boutique. To help you remember each dress and make an informed decision, take photos of each dress. This will allow you to review the dresses later and compare them side by side.

How to customize your boho wedding dress

Choosing the right accessories is crucial to completing your boho bridal look. Here are some tips to help you customize your boho wedding dress:

Headpieces: Boho wedding dresses lend themselves beautifully to a variety of headpieces. Consider a flower crown for a whimsical and romantic touch. Opt for delicate floral hairpins or a boho-inspired headband for a more delicate and ethereal look. If you prefer something more subtle, an elegant crystal or pearl headpiece can add a touch of sparkle without overpowering the dress.


Shoes: When it comes to footwear, boho brides often choose sandals, flats or even bare feet for a beach wedding. Look for sandals with intricate beading or delicate lace-up details to complement the bohemian vibe. If you prefer a bit of height, consider wedges with woven or natural materials for a relaxed yet elegant look.


Jewelry: Keep your jewelry simple and let the dress take center stage. Choose delicate pieces with a bohemian flair, such as elegant bracelets in gold or silver, layered necklaces with small pendants or statement earrings with natural gemstones. Avoid heavy or bulky jewelry as it can detract from the light and airy feel of the dress.


Veil or no veil: The decision to wear a veil is completely personal and depends on the overall look you want to achieve. If you're going for a more traditional boho look, consider a lace veil that complements the dress. Alternatively, you can forgo the veil altogether and opt for a delicate tulle or chiffon cape, a flower crown or a statement hairpiece to add a bohemian touch to your bridal look.


Bouquet: Your bouquet is an essential accessory that can tie your boho look together. Choose loose, unstructured bouquets with a mix of wildflowers, greenery and delicate blooms. Incorporate elements like feathers, ribbons or lace to enhance the bohemian feel. Consider earthy, muted tones or vibrant colors to complement your wedding color palette.

 

Remember, the key to customizing your boho wedding dress is to choose pieces that complement the dress without overpowering it. Consider the overall aesthetic and choose accessories that enhance the bohemian vibe you're aiming for.
